Choosing Between Semi-Submersible and Submersible Pumps
When it comes to pumping water, there are two key types of pumps available. Amongst these, semi-submersible and submersible pumps stand out as popular choices for various applications. To make an informed decision, it's crucial to understand the distinct characteristics that set them apart.
Semi-submersible pumps are designed to operate partially submerged in liquids. This means the pump motor remains exterior to the water level, ensuring its protection from wear and tear. Submersible pumps, on the other hand, are completely submerged underneath the liquid they're pumping. Their drive system is entirely enclosed within a robust housing that can withstand the pressure of being fully underwater.
- Semi-Submersible pumps are typically used for applications where a limited amount of liquid are involved. Examples include irrigation, drainage, and limited industrial processes.
- Submersible pumps excel in handling deep submersion scenarios. They are commonly found in applications like wells, sewage treatment plants, and large agricultural operations.
